c语言中数组的三种类型
1、一维数组,声明时数组名称前面的类型是数组元素的类型。例:inta[4];这表明一个整型数组的长度是4,每个元素都是一个整型数组。分组的赋值方法如下:数组类型 数组名 [自定义数组的长度] 数组名[下标]=值int 数组名[数组的长度]={数组的第一个元素,数组的第二个元素,... ,数组的第N个元...
2024-01-10c语言中有哪些循环语句
1、while属于当型循环。是控制表达式在循环体之前的循环语句。while (表达式) 语句2、do-while属于型循环。do 语句while(表达式);3、for可以省略三种表达式。for (表达式1; 表达式2; 表达式3) 语句4、break退出switch结构。还可以终止循环,一个break语句层循环中只跳出一层循环。5、continu...
2024-01-10c语言printf输出函数的介绍
说明1、printf可输出各种类型的数据。2、是最灵活、最复杂、最常用的输出函数之一,它通过格式控制符对输出进行格式控制。函数原型在头文件stdio.h中。但是作为特例,在使用printf函数之前,不需要包含stdio.h文件。语法printf(“格式控制字符串”, 输出表列)实例#include <stdio.h> int main(){int m = 192...
2024-01-10c语言scanf()输入函数的介绍
说明1、scanf是格式输入函数,功能是在屏幕上输入指定的信息。简而言之,类似于printf但不同。2、按照指定的格式读取键盘上输入的几种任意类型的数据,并存储在argument参数指向的内存单元中。函数返回值是读取并赋予argument的数据数,如果错误,返回0。语法scanf("格式字符串",输入项首地址列表);实...
2024-01-10c语言中有哪些运算符
说明1、基本运算符:加法,减法,除法,乘法,取模运算,自增,自减。2、关系运算符:大于,等于,全等,大于等于,非等于。3、逻辑运算符:且,或,非。实例//zouyan#include <stdio.h>main(){ int i,j,k; k=30; i=k++; printf("i=%d,k=%d",i,k); j=++k; printf("\nj=%d,k=%d",j,k);}以上就是c语言中...
2024-01-10c语言数据类型转换的方法
说明1、自动转换不需要我们介入,当不同数据类型的量混合操作时,编译系统会自动完成。例如在赋值操作中,右边表达式的值与左边的数据类型不同,会自动将右边的表达式转换成与左边相同的类型。2、强制转换就是我们自己去做的转换形式:(新类型)表达式。自动转换实例#include <stdio.h>#include <s...
2024-01-10pythonraise触发异常的实现
说明1、直接判断传入参数是否等于0,如果等于0直接抛出异常,外层except语句捕获打印异常信息。2、捕获异常后如果这个代码不处理异常,可以在except语句中直接raise抛出异常。实例def calculate_num(num): try: if num == 0: raise Exception("除数不能为0") print(10/num...
2024-01-10pythonAxes3D绘制3D图形
说明1、绘制3D坐标的函数Axes3D。创建绘图对象,用这个绘图对象创建Axes对象。2、X轴-2到2之间,Y轴-2到2之间。用两个坐标轴上的点在平面上画格,X和Y的平方和开根号。3、计算sin函数赋值为Z坐标。具体函数方法可用 help(function) 查看4、给三个坐标轴注明。实例# -*- coding: utf-8 -*-#By:Eastmount CSDNfrom ma...
2024-01-10python用plt.pie绘制饼图
说明1、调用plt.pie()绘制,计算各项所占比例。参数fracs表示比例。2、explode表示离开整个圆形的距离。例如与0.08的距离。3、labels表示类标。4、shadow=True表示图形有阴影。5、startangle表示开始角度。默认值为0。实例# -*- coding: utf-8 -*-#By:Eastmount CSDNimport matplotlib.pyplot as plt #每一块占得比例,总和...
2024-01-10python绘制散点图的两种方法
说明1、调用scatter()函数,调用scatter()从给出的一堆随机点(包括x,y坐标)中绘制散点图。它可以单独控制每个散点与数据的匹配,使每个散点具有不同的属性。2、另一种是调用plot()函数。实例# -*- coding: utf-8 -*-#By:Eastmount CSDNimport numpy as npimport matplotlib.pyplot as plt #构造数据x = np.random.randn(200)...
2024-01-10